Code P085E Description
The diagnostic trouble code P085E indicates that there is a performance issue with the Gear Shift Control Module 'B'. This module is responsible for controlling the gear shifting process in automatic transmission vehicles. When this code is triggered, it means that the module is not functioning properly, which can lead to various issues with the vehicle's transmission system.
Common Causes of P085E
- Faulty gear shift control module
- Damaged wiring or connectors
- Malfunctioning transmission control module
- Electrical issues within the transmission system
- Fluid contamination in the transmission
Symptoms of P085E
- Difficulty shifting gears
- Delayed or harsh gear shifts
- Transmission slipping
- Illumination of the Check Engine Light
- Transmission not engaging properly
How to Fix P085E
- Diagnose the specific cause of the code by using a scan tool to retrieve the trouble codes and perform a thorough inspection of the gear shift control module and related components.
- Repair or replace any damaged wiring or connectors in the transmission system.
- Test the gear shift control module for proper function and replace if necessary.
- Clear the trouble codes from the vehicle's memory and test drive the vehicle to ensure that the issue has been resolved.
- Perform a transmission fluid flush and refill to ensure optimal performance of the transmission system.
Cost to Fix P085E
The typical repair costs for addressing the P085E code can range from $200 to $600, including parts and labor. However, the specific diagnosis time and labor rates at auto repair shops can vary based on factors such as location, vehicle make and model, and engine type. It's advisable to check local rates for a more precise estimate. Most auto repair shops commonly charge between $80 and $150 per hour, but rates in metropolitan areas or at dealerships may be higher, while independent shops often charge less.
